Webequinox noun equi· nox ˈē-kwə-ˌnäks ˈe- 1 : either of the two points on the celestial sphere where the celestial equator intersects the ecliptic 2 : either of the two times each year (as about March 21 and September 23) when the sun crosses the equator and day and night are everywhere on earth of approximately equal length Did you know?
